A compliance division identifies risks that an organization faces and advises on how to avoid or handle them. Compliance screens and reviews on the effectiveness of controls within the administration of the organizations threat publicity. The department additionally resolves compliance points https://www.xcritical.com/ as they come up and suggested the business on guidelines and controls. A compliance program is an organization’s set of internal insurance policies and procedures put into place so as to adjust to laws, rules, and rules or to uphold the business’s reputation.

Brokers register with the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A), the broker-dealers’ self-regulatory physique. In serving their shoppers, brokers are held to a standard of conduct based on the “suitability rule,” which requires there be affordable grounds for recommending a particular product or investment. The second a half of the rule, generally known as “know your customer,” or KYC, addresses the steps a dealer must use to identify their consumer and their financial savings goals, which helps them set up the affordable grounds for the recommendation. FINRA’s KYC requirements are part of Article 2090 of FINRA, titled “Know Your Customer,” which mandates that all members should conduct reasonable due diligence about their prospects. This due diligence contains “essential” details about that buyer, from private identification to a financial situation.
